基于人工智能的分批式混合机控制方法及系统技术方案

技术编号:33836349 阅读:20 留言:0更新日期:2022-06-16 11:53
本发明专利技术涉及人工智能技术领域,具体涉及一种基于人工智能的分批式混合机控制方法及系统。该方法采集混合机内部的RGB图像得到颜色的整体分层边界线;基于像素点的周围像素点的色调得到整体分层边界线上每个像素点对应的颜色类别数量以获取多段分层边界线;根据分层边界线的长度和每个像素点的斜率得到每段分层边界线的线段复杂度以获取整体分层边界线的分层程度;由分层程度对混合机的固定混合时间进行自适应调整。通过分析不同颜色粉末在混合过程中的分层边界线以获取混合过程中的分层程度,由分层程度对固定混合时间进行自适应调整,不但能够得到一个混合彻底的结果,而且也会提高混合的效率。也会提高混合的效率。也会提高混合的效率。

【技术实现步骤摘要】
基于人工智能的分批式混合机控制方法及系统


[0001]本专利技术涉及人工智能
,具体涉及一种基于人工智能的分批式混合机控制方法及系统。

技术介绍

[0002]随着科技的发展,传统的人力混合已经被智能的混合机取代,目前,混合机在石油化工、生物医药、环保、纺织、食品加工等行业都广泛使用,混合机的类型包括V型混合机、无重力混合机和分批式混合机等等,其中分批式混合机是指混合机对目标物体进行分批次的混合。
[0003]对于粉末制药的制作过程中,由于混合机的混合时间是固定设置好的,当分批式混合机在混合不同颜色粉末时,固定时间一方面会造成在混合时间到达时,其混合机内部仍未混合均匀,存在分层现象,导致混合结果不理想,另一方面固定时间设置较长时会降低混合效率。

技术实现思路

[0004]为了解决上述技术问题,本专利技术的目的在于提供一种基于人工智能的分批式混合机控制方法及系统,所采用的技术方案具体如下:
[0005]本专利技术一个实施例提供了一种基于人工智能的分批式混合机控制方法,该方法包括:
[0006]在不同颜色粉末的混合过程中,采集混合机内部的RGB图像,对所述RGB图像进行颜色阈值分割得到颜色的整体分层边界线;
[0007]基于像素点的周围像素点的色调得到所述整体分层边界线上每个像素点对应的颜色类别数量,由所述颜色类别数量对所述整体分层边界线进行分段得到多段分层边界线;基于图像坐标系,根据像素点的坐标分别拟合每段所述分层边界线的曲线,由所述曲线得到所述分层边界线上每个像素点的斜率;
[0008]根据所述分层边界线的长度和每个像素点的所述斜率得到每段所述分层边界线的线段复杂度;获取每段所述分层边界线的中心点,结合每段所述分层边界线的所述中心点和所述线段复杂度得到所述整体分层边界线的分层程度;
[0009]由所述分层程度对所述混合机的固定混合时间进行自适应调整。
[0010]优选的,所述周围像素点的获取方法,包括:
[0011]设定滑窗尺寸,利用所述滑窗得到所述整体分层边界线上每个像素点的所述周边像素点。
[0012]优选的,所述由所述颜色类别数量对所述整体分层边界线进行分段得到多段分层边界线的方法,包括:
[0013]获取所述颜色类别数量大于或等于3时所述整体分层边界上对应的多个第一像素点,根据所述第一像素点得到所述整体分层边界线对应的多段所述分层边界线。
[0014]优选的,所述根据所述分层边界线的长度和每个像素点的所述斜率得到每段所述分层边界线的线段复杂度的方法,包括:
[0015]获取所述分层边界线上像素点的数量,将所述数量作为分层边界线的长度;基于每段所述分层边界线上所有像素点的所述斜率,将相同的所述斜率构成一个斜率类别以得到多个所述斜率类别,统计每个所述斜率类别中所述斜率的个数,由所述个数和所述长度得到每段所述分层边界线的所述线段复杂度。
[0016]优选的,所述结合每段所述分层边界线的所述中心点和所述线段复杂度得到所述整体分层边界线的分层程度的方法,包括:
[0017]对于所有的所述分层边界线,由所述中心点分别计算每两段所述分层边界线之间的距离,由所述线段复杂度计算对应两段所述分层边界线之间的复杂度总和,结合所述距离与所述复杂度总和得到所述整体分层边界线的分层程度。
[0018]优选的,其特征在于,所述线段复杂度的计算公式为:
[0019][0020]其中,C为所述线段复杂度;v为所述斜率类别的数量;p
i
为第i个斜率类别对应的所述个数;N为像素点的数量。
[0021]优选的,所述分层程度与所述距离呈正相关、所述分层程度与所述复杂度总和呈正相关。
[0022]进一步地,本专利技术实施例提供了一种基于人工智能的分批式混合机控制系统,包括存储器、处理器以及存储在所述存储器中并可在所述处理器上运行的计算机程序,其特征在于,所述处理器执行所述计算机程序时实现上述任意一项所述方法的步骤。
[0023]本专利技术实施例至少具有如下有益效果:通过分析不同颜色粉末在混合过程中的分层边界线以获取混合过程中的分层程度,由分层程度对混合时间进行自适应调整,不但能够得到一个混合彻底的结果,而且也会提高混合的效率。
附图说明
[0024]为了更清楚地说明本专利技术实施例或现有技术中的技术方案和优点,下面将对实施例或现有技术描述中所需要使用的附图作简单的介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其它附图。
[0025]图1为本专利技术一个实施例提供的一种基于人工智能的分批式混合机控制方法的步骤流程图;
[0026]图2为本专利技术实施例中所提供的关于混合机内部的RGB图像的示意图;
[0027]图3为本专利技术实施例中所提供的关于整体分层边界线的示意图。
具体实施方式
[0028]为了更进一步阐述本专利技术为达成预定专利技术目的所采取的技术手段及功效,以下结合附图及较佳实施例,对依据本专利技术提出的一种基于人工智能的分批式混合机控制方法及
系统,其具体实施方式、结构、特征及其功效,详细说明如下。在下述说明中,不同的“一个实施例”或“另一个实施例”指的不一定是同一实施例。此外,一或多个实施例中的特定特征、结构、或特点可由任何合适形式组合。
[0029]除非另有定义,本文所使用的所有的技术和科学术语与属于本专利技术的
的技术人员通常理解的含义相同。
[0030]下面结合附图具体的说明本专利技术所提供的一种基于人工智能的分批式混合机控制方法及系统的具体方案。
[0031]本专利技术实施例所针对的具体场景为:适用于粉末制药过程中,且该过程中选用具有观察口的分批式混合机,在观察口处架设相机,利用相机采集混合机内部图像。
[0032]需要说明的是,本专利技术实施例中相机采用RGB相机,使得采集的图像足够清楚以能够识别出各物料的分界限。
[0033]请参阅图1,其示出了本专利技术一个实施例提供的一种基于人工智能的分批式混合机控制方法的步骤流程图,该方法包括以下步骤:
[0034]步骤S001,在不同颜色粉末的混合过程中,采集混合机内部的RGB图像,对RGB图像进行颜色阈值分割得到颜色的整体分层边界线。
[0035]具体的,在不同颜色粉末的混合过程中,其粉末由于未混合均匀会出现分层现象,进而采集混合机内部的RGB图像,如图2所示。
[0036]将采集得到RGB图像转化HSV颜色空间的第一图像,统计第一图像中色调(H)分量的直方图,对H值的直方图取top

n,n为对直方图平滑去噪后峰值检测的峰值个数,得到颜色分割阈值,使用得到的颜色份分割阈值,对得到第一图像进行颜色分割,对分割结果采用Canny边缘检测算子,将边缘检测结果,采用按位与操作叠加到第一图像中,得到不同颜色之间的整体分层边界线,如图3所示。
[0037]步骤本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于人工智能的分批式混合机控制方法,其特征在于,该方法包括:在不同颜色粉末的混合过程中,采集混合机内部的RGB图像,对所述RGB图像进行颜色阈值分割得到颜色的整体分层边界线;基于像素点的周围像素点的色调得到所述整体分层边界线上每个像素点对应的颜色类别数量,由所述颜色类别数量对所述整体分层边界线进行分段得到多段分层边界线;基于图像坐标系,根据像素点的坐标分别拟合每段所述分层边界线的曲线,由所述曲线得到所述分层边界线上每个像素点的斜率;根据所述分层边界线的长度和每个像素点的所述斜率得到每段所述分层边界线的线段复杂度;获取每段所述分层边界线的中心点,结合每段所述分层边界线的所述中心点和所述线段复杂度得到所述整体分层边界线的分层程度;由所述分层程度对所述混合机的固定混合时间进行自适应调整。2.如权利要求1所述的方法,其特征在于,所述周围像素点的获取方法,包括:设定滑窗尺寸,利用所述滑窗得到所述整体分层边界线上每个像素点的所述周边像素点。3.如权利要求1所述的方法,其特征在于,所述由所述颜色类别数量对所述整体分层边界线进行分段得到多段分层边界线的方法,包括:获取所述颜色类别数量大于或等于3时所述整体分层边界上对应的多个第一像素点,根据所述第一像素点得到所述整体分层边界线对应的多段所述分层边界线。4.如权利要求1所述的方法,其特征在于,所述根据所述分层边界线的长度和每个像素点的所述斜...

【专利技术属性】
技术研发人员:王由发
申请(专利权)人:江苏铭瀚智能科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1